A five-run bottom of the first was plenty for the Lady Pointers as they got a much-needed 7A-West win at home on Friday.

Van Buren (12-11, 4-7) had three players with two-hit games. Whitney Ellis was 2-for-3 and drove in four runs, a two-run triple in the first as well as a two-run single in the fourth to give the Lady Pointers a 7-2 lead.

Hannah Brewer also was 2-for-4, including an RBI single in the first. Caroline Davis was 2-for-4 as well.

Richelle Stacy was the winning pitcher. She went all seven innings, giving up two runs on six hits. Stacy didn’t walk a single batter and she struck out three.
